What Are Omnivores? The Ultimate Guide to Understanding Omnivorous Diets

An omnivore is an organism that derives nutrition from a combination of plant and animal matter. This dietary strategy provides a flexible survival advantage, allowing these consumers to thrive in a wide array of environments. Unlike strict herbivores or carnivores, their physiology is adapted to process a diverse range of organic materials efficiently.

Defining the Omnivorous Diet

The core characteristic of an omnivore is its metabolic versatility. These animals possess digestive systems capable of breaking down both cellulose found in vegetation and the proteins and fats abundant in meat. This dual capability means their food sources are not limited to a single trophic level, making them highly adaptable feeders in their respective ecosystems.

Omnivores in the Food Web

In any given ecosystem, omnivores often play a critical role in balancing populations. They consume a variety of organisms, which helps control the numbers of insects, small mammals, and plant life. This complex interaction positions them as vital connectors within the food web, transferring energy from primary producers up to higher-level consumers.

Examples in the Animal Kingdom

Humans, bears, and raccoons are classic examples of vertebrate omnivores.

Many bird species, such as crows and chickens, exhibit omnivorous feeding habits.

Invertebrates like certain species of crabs and beetles also fall into this dietary category.

Physiological Adaptations

Anatomically, omnivores display features that support their varied intake. For instance, human jaws and teeth are structured for both tearing meat and grinding plant matter. Similarly, their digestive tracts are generally longer than those of obligate carnivores, allowing for the thorough breakdown of complex carbohydrates.
